Few jewellers are as celebrated as Cartier, even fewer have as many instantly recognizable designs - some of which, such as the Tank watch, Love bracelet and Trinity ring, have become iconic.
Glamorous, witty, beautiful and beloved of stars such as Grace Kelly, over 150 dazzling Cartier pieces are featured here. This book presents jewels from superlative collections, including the V&A and the Royal Collection, as well as Cartier's own private collection and it celebrates the history of the company The Prince of Wales, later King Edward VII, called the 'Jeweller of Kings and the King of Jewellers'.
Helen Molesworth spent ten years as a jewellery specialist for Sotheby's and Christie's auction houses in London and Geneva, before joining Gubelin as Managing Director to create and run the coloured gemstone Academy. She is now Senior Curator of Jewellery at the Victoria and Albert Museum.
Rachel Garrahan is Project Curator at the Victoria and Albert Museum. Before that she was the award-winning Jewellery and Watch Director at British Vogue. She is a Freeman of the Worshipful Company of Goldsmiths, and has written widely on luxury, art and culture for a broad range of publications.
